Common Myths Concerning Acne
When it comes to acne, lots of people rely on typical myths that can result in confusion and frustration. One prevalent myth is that consuming delicious chocolate or greasy foods triggers acne. While diet can influence skin wellness, the straight web link in between particular foods and acne isn't as precise as many believe.
Another common mistaken belief is that you should scrub your face vigorously to clear up breakouts. In reality, hostile scrubbing can aggravate your skin and aggravate acne.
You may likewise think that acne only affects teens, yet grownups can experience it as well, typically because of hormonal adjustments or anxiety. Some individuals think that tanning can clear up acne, however sunlight exposure can really cause skin damage and get worse breakouts in the long run.

Scientific Details Behind Acne
Understanding the clinical truths behind acne can encourage you to tackle this usual skin problem more effectively.
Acne takes place when hair follicles end up being obstructed with oil, dead skin cells, and germs. This procedure often begins with an overflow of sebum, the oil your skin normally creates. Hormonal modifications, especially throughout puberty or menstruation, can activate this excess oil.
Microorganisms referred to as Propionibacterium acnes grow in these blocked pores, bring about inflammation. When your body immune system reacts, it can create redness and swelling, leading to those bothersome pimples or cysts.
Genetics also play a role; if your parents had acne, you may be more vulnerable to it.
Diet regimen and stress and anxiety degrees can influence acne as well, however research study is still evolving in these areas. While enjoying greasy foods will not straight cause breakouts, a well balanced diet can sustain your skin health and wellness.

Tips for Taking Care Of Acne
Managing acne successfully requires a mix of daily skincare routines and way of living changes. Beginning by developing a regular skin care regimen. Cleanse your face two times a day with a mild, non-comedogenic cleanser to get rid of dirt and excess oil. Avoid rubbing too hard, as this can irritate your skin and aggravate acne.
Next, incorporate items containing sal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ide to help protect against outbreaks. Constantly follow up with a lightweight, oil-free cream to keep your skin hydrated. Don't fail to remember sun block; go with non-comedogenic options to protect your skin from UV damages without clogging pores.
Past skincare, take note of your diet. Limit sweet and oily foods, and concentrate on f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. Staying moisturized is essential, so beverage plenty of water throughout the day.
In addition, handle stress and anxiety with tasks like yoga, meditation, or workout, as anxiety can set off breakouts.
